A values-driven school in Readingis seeking a passionate Religious Education Teacher to join its dedicated team. This is an opportunity to help students explore faith, ethics, and philosophy in a supportive and academically ambitious environment.

If you believe in the power of Religious Education to develop critical thinking, empathy, and a deeper understanding of the world, we would love to hear from you.

Why Join This School?

A School with Purpose – Encourage students to engage with faith, morality, and spirituality in a respectful and thought-provoking setting.

Engaged and Inquisitive Students – Teach young minds eager to discuss, debate, and understand different worldviews.

Supportive and Collaborative Culture – Join a team that values professional growth, well-being, and innovation in teaching.

Modern Resources and Facilities – Benefit from digital learning tools, interactive teaching materials, and innovative classroom approaches.

Career Progression and Development – Access continuous professional development, mentorship programs, and leadership opportunities.

Smaller Class Sizes – Build strong connections with students and personalize their learning experience.

The Role
  • Teach Religious Education across Key Stages, inspiring students to engage with ethical and philosophical discussions.
  • Use a range of modern teaching methods, including technology-enhanced learning, to create a dynamic classroom environment.
  • Foster critical thinking, debate, and personal reflection to help students develop a deeper understanding of religious and moral issues.
  • Support the school’s ethos through extracurricular activities, such as faith-based discussions, philosophy clubs, and social justice projects.
  • Work closely with colleagues to enhance the Religious Education curriculum and drive innovation in teaching.
